Learning in Parkinson's disease: eyeblink conditioning, declarative learning, and procedural learning. (17/6977)

OBJECTIVE: To assess the degree of learning ability in Parkinson's disease. METHODS: Three different learning tasks: eyeblink classical conditioning with delay and trace paradigms, the California verbal learning test (CVLT), and a serial reaction time task (SRTT) were studied in patients with Parkinson's disease and normal (control) subjects. RESULTS: In the eyeblink conditioning tasks, both patients and normal subjects showed significant learning effects without between group differences. In the CVLT, patients remembered significantly fewer words than normal subjects in both short term and long term cued recall tasks. In the SRTT, normal subjects had significantly reduced response time and error rates across blocks of repeated sequence trials, whereas patients had significantly reduced error, but not response time rates. CONCLUSION: Impairment of nigrostriatal pathways selectively affects performance in complex learning tasks that are competitive and require alertness such as the SRTT, but not in simple learning procedures such as eyeblink conditioning.  (+info)

Right frontal lobe slow frequency repetitive transcranial magnetic stimulation (SF r-TMS) is an effective treatment for depression: a case-control pilot study of safety and efficacy. (18/6977)

Major depression may result from decreased left frontal lobe function with respect to the right. Fast frequency repetitive transcranial magnetic stimulation (FF r-TMS) excites the underlying cortex whereas slow frequency repetitive transcranial magnetic stimulation (SF r-TMS) causes cortical inhibition. Left frontal FF r-TMS attenuates major depression whereas the inhibitory effects of right frontal SF r-TMS are unknown. This study tested the hypothesis that right frontal SF r-TMS would treat depressed patients with minimal effect on controls. A psychiatrist administered the Beck depression inventory and Hamilton D depression rating scales to eight depressed patients and six controls before and after the treatment protocol. Eight sessions of 100 right frontal lobe SF r-TMS were given at motor threshold and 0.5 Hz over a 6 week period. No adverse outcomes were noted in either group. A significant antidepressant effect was noted in depressed patients on the Beck and Hamilton D depression rating scales (p<0.05). No change on either scale was noted in the controls. In conclusion right frontal lobe SF r-TMS is a safe, non-invasive treatment for major depression that deserves further investigation.  (+info)

Neuroendocrine and psychophysiologic responses in PTSD: a symptom provocation study. (19/6977)

Biological research on post-traumatic stress disorder (PTSD) has focused on autonomic, sympatho-adrenal, and hypothalamo-pituitary-adrenal (HPA) axis systems. Interactions among these response modalities have not been well studied and may be illuminating. We examined subjective, autonomic, adrenergic, and HPA axis responses in a trauma-cue paradigm and explored the hypothesis that the ability of linked stress-response systems to mount integrated responses to environmental threat would produce strong correlations across systems. Seventeen veterans with PTSD, 11 veteran controls without PTSD, and 14 nonveteran controls were exposed to white noise and combat sounds on separate days. Subjective distress, heart rate, skin conductance, plasma catecholamines, ACTH, and cortisol, at baseline and in response to the auditory stimuli, were analyzed for group differences and for patterns of interrelationships. PTSD patients exhibited higher skin conductance, heart rate, plasma cortisol, and catecholamines at baseline, and exaggerated responses to combat sounds in skin conductance, heart rate, plasma epinephrine, and norepinephrine, but not ACTH. The control groups did not differ on any measure. In canonical correlation analyses, no significant correlations were found between response systems. Thus, PTSD patients showed heightened responsivity to trauma-related cues in some, but not all, response modalities. The data did not support the integrated, multisystem stress response in PTSD that had been hypothesized. Individual response differences or differing pathophysiological processes may determine which neurobiological system is affected in any given patient.  (+info)

Neurovascular deficits in cocaine abusers. (20/6977)

The nature of the neurological and cerebrovascular deficits in cocaine abusers and whether they persist in abstinence is unclear. Blood flow velocity of the anterior and middle cerebral arteries was measured by transcranial Doppler sonography in cocaine abusers (n = 50) and control subjects (n = 25). Blood flow velocity was measured within 3 days and again after about 28 days after being admitted to an inpatient research ward to determine whether blood flow velocity improved during monitored abstinence conditions. The mean, systolic, and diastolic velocities as well as the pulsatility index in middle and anterior cerebral arteries significantly differed between controls and cocaine abusers (p < .05). Cerebrovascular resistance is increased in cocaine abusers and the increase persists for over a month of abstinence. Further research is needed to determine whether cerebrovascular resistance can be improved by pharmacological manipulations and whether improved blood flow relates to improved treatment outcome.  (+info)

Alcohol-related problems among adolescent suicides in Finland. (21/6977)

We studied 106 adolescent suicides out of a total nationwide population of 1397 suicides. Forty-four (42%) of these 13-22-year-old victims were classified as having suffered either a DSM-III-R alcohol use disorder or diagnostically subthreshold alcohol misuse according to retrospective evaluation using the Michigan Alcoholism Screening Test (MAST). These victims were found to differ from the other adolescent suicides in several characteristics: they were more likely to have comorbid categorical DSM-III-R disorders, antisocial behaviour, disturbed family backgrounds, precipitating life-events as stressors and severe psychosocial impairment. In addition, they also had a greater tendency to be alcohol-intoxicated at the time of the suicidal act, which tended to occur during weekends, suggesting that drinking in itself, and its weekly pattern, each contributed to the completion of their suicides.  (+info)

Drinking pattern and alcohol-related medical disorders. (22/6977)

Although heavy alcohol intake is known to be one of the most common causative factors of liver disease, pancreatitis, upper gastrointestinal and neurological disorders, the influence of the drinking pattern is largely unknown. The study investigated the relationship of alcohol-related medical disorders in alcoholics and their drinking pattern. Two hundred and forty-one chronic alcoholics were referred consecutively for detoxification and their drinking pattern was sufficient for them to be included in this study. History of alcohol abuse as well as drinking behaviour in the last 6 months were assessed by a semi-structured interview. Findings included intensive clinical examination with abdominal ultrasound in most subjects. Heavy drinking with frequent inebriation was most often found in our sample (44.4%), whereas continuous heavy alcohol consumption without intoxication (33.6%), and an episodic drinking style (22.0%) were less frequent. The heavy drinkers suffered more often from pancreatitis, oesophageal varices, polyneuropathy or erectile dysfunction than episodic drinkers. They also showed more upper gastrointestinal disorders, although the estimated life-time alcohol intake was comparable to continuous drinkers. No difference relating to withdrawal delirium or seizures could be found between the groups of alcoholics. Frequent heavy drinkers showed a trend to more alcohol-related medical disorders than alcoholics with a different drinking pattern, although they were younger and their estimated life-time alcohol intake was comparable to that of continuous drinkers. Thus, the drinking pattern, particularly frequent inebriation, has an influence on the occurrence of alcohol-related disorders.  (+info)

Patients with chronic alcohol abuse in Dutch family practices. (23/6977)

Routine data from the Dutch Transition project on 236 027 episodes of care collected by 54 family physicians (FPs) for 93 297 patient years in their listed practices and classified with the International Classification of Primary Care, were used to analyse chronic alcohol abuse episodes of care in Dutch family practices. Data on 332 episodes are presented. In a subsample with a 4-year registration period, 70 patients were identified. Important reasons for an encounter are the patient's explicit presentation of the problem and the FPs' initiatives. FPs show considerable sensitivity to psychosocial problems, including alcohol abuse. It is concluded that over the years registered FPs actively deal with chronic alcohol abuse in approximately 2% of all visiting men aged 25-64 years. In an average Dutch family practice with 2200 listed patients, approximately 20 patients are known by the FP to have chronic alcohol abuse. Real life studies in registered family practice populations are necessary to better establish how patients with abundant alcohol consumption as a risk factor develop the chronic alcohol abuse episode of care, and what FPs can do to prevent this effectively.  (+info)

Risperidone versus haloperidol on secondary memory: can newer medications aid learning? (24/6977)

The introduction of the new generation of antipsychotic medications for the treatment of schizophrenia has been accompanied by a growing interest in the neurocognitive effects of these drugs. The present study compared the effects of risperidone and haloperidol on secondary memory in a group of treatment-resistant schizophrenia patients. The study design included a baseline phase and two double-blind phases in which patients were randomly assigned to medication under two different dose conditions (fixed dose and flexible dose). Secondary memory was assessed at baseline, fixed-dose, and flexible-dose phases, using the California Verbal Learning Test (CVLT). Six measures were selected, which formed three factors (general verbal learning ability, retention, and learning strategy). Risperidone-treated patients showed greater improvement than haloperidol-treated patients in general verbal learning ability, a finding characterized by significant treatment effects on CVLT measures of learning acquisition, recall consistency, and recognition memory. After controlling for benztropine status, differences on the measures of learning acquisition and recall consistency remained significant, and differences in recognition memory weakened slightly (p = 0.07). No significant treatment effects were noted on retention or learning strategy. These findings suggest that risperidone may exert a facilitating effect on the acquisition of new verbal information, an effect that does not appear to be due to the activation of semantic encoding strategies.  (+info)
